Windsor makes Top 25 list of Canadas bed buggiest cities …

Windsor has ranked number 12 on Orkin Canadas list of the Top 25 bed bug cities in Canada.

Windsor moved up quite a bit on the list compared to 2020 where the city ranked 21st of 25 as the worst cities for bed bugs.

Toronto has been ranked as the top worst city for bed bugs in Canada the second year in a row.

Orkin says the rankings are based on the number of commercial and bed bug treatments performed in Canada by the countrys largest pest control provider from Jan. 1, 2021 to Dec. 31, 2022.

Rounding out the top five worst cities for bed bugs is Sudbury in second, Vancouver in third, St. Johns in fourth and Oshawa in fifth.

Orkin says bed bugs are extremely efficient hitch hikers.

They can move easily across a room and climb onto luggage or anything left on a bed in just one night, a news release from Orkin Canada says.

These Canadian Cities Apparently Have The Most Bed Bugs & Ew, Just Ew – Narcity Canada

Bug-phobes be warned! While some Canadians will be no strangers to bugs, a new study has uncovered the cities in Canada with the most bed bugs and can we just say, ew?

According to pest control company Orkin, a whole bunch of Canadian cities actually have bed bug problems.

It determined the worst spots affected by looking at which places sought the most bed bug treatments between January 1, 2021, and December 31, 2021, in both residential and commercial spaces.

Unsurprisingly, the most bed bug-ed out city in the country is also the biggest Toronto. After that, the list gets a little more surprising.

Number two on the list is Sudbury and then comes Vancouver.

In the fourth slot is St. John's, Newfoundland, then Oshawa, followed by Scarborough and Moncton. The final three in the top ten are Saint John, Winnipeg and Edmonton respectively.

Interestingly enough, the major population centre of Montreal is all the way down at 17th place on the list. Same with Calgary, at 18, and Halifax, at 23.

A map featuring the Canadian cities with the most bed bugsOrkin

If you're feeling a little itchy after this news, Orkin has some great tips to help prevent bed bug infestation.

When travelling, always store your luggage on the hotel's metal luggage racks which they can't easily climb up and put your clothes and other things in plastic bags.

The experts also recommend not putting your clothes on the bed, because if the bed is infested with the little beasties, they make expert "hitch-hikers."

Bed bugs love dark and cool places, which means hotels and homes aren't the only place they can be found. It's rare, but you can even pick up bed bugs from places like bus, train and airplane seats and rental cars.

What The F*ck News: This Full Block In Toronto With A History Of Bed Bugs, Roach Infestations And So Many Fires Is On Sale For Close To $19M – 6ixBuzz

What would you do with nearly $19 million bucks to throw away? Probably not spend it on an entire block that has a history of bug infestations and multiple fires, right?

In case you are down for it though, its currently on the market and up for grabs.

Thats right, Four separate but close properties in Parkdale Village are officially on sale for reportedly $18,750,000.

Colliers, a real-estate agency in Canada, listed the multi-family buildings on their site.

According to them, the property presents investors with an opportunity to acquire four separate properties, totaling 62 suites + 2 office suites, the agency said.

This is a unique opportunity to reposition an apartment building in downtown Toronto.

Seemingly every property on sale (2, 4, 6, and 8 Laxton Avenue) has a bit of a rough history.

BlogTO reports that one of the properties, a building with 52 units, has a record of bed bugs and roach infestations.

Thats not all, 4 Laxton Avenue also has a past following a big fire in January.

The Parkdale Residents Association (PRA) noted that this was actually the third major fire on Laxton Avenue in Parkdale in just one year alone.

Do You Need a Pest Inspection to Buy a Home?

Image via Unsplash

When buying a home, you hire a home inspector to check for signs of damage, safety hazards, and issues you want to know about as a homebuyer. However, home inspectors only report on what’s in plain view. General home inspectors aren’t responsible for checking for signs of troublesome pests like termites and bed bugs.

Specialized pest inspections are a smart choice for home buyers, especially in states like New Jersey where wood-destroying insects like carpenter ants, termites, and powder post beetles are common.

The risks of forgoing a pest inspection

Do you really need a pest inspection? Consider these risks of forgoing a specialized pest inspection.

  • Household pests damage your home, carry bacteria and disease, and cause uncomfortable itching and scratching.
  • Undetected, a pest problem could cost a homebuyer hundreds to thousands of dollars in pest control services.
  • Some lenders and loan programs require a Wood Destroying Insect Report before granting a mortgage.
  • When buying as-is, your only recourse for pest problems is to commission an inspection before entering a contract.

What to expect from a pest inspection

A standard pest inspection looks for signs of damage from destructive pests like ants, beetles, bees, wasps, and rodents.

  • Pest inspections start around $75 and vary based on location and home size. The cost of a pest inspection doesn’t include treatment.
  • A WDIR is typically separate from a general pest inspection. After looking for evidence of wood-destroying insects, a certified inspector issues a report for your mortgage provider.
  • Bed bugs are another problem a standard pest inspection may not cover. Look for a company that specializes in bed bugs if buying in an area with bed bug infestations.

Your dream house has pests. Now what?

Pest problems don’t have to be a deal-breaker when buying a home.

  • Upon finding a pest infestation, buyers can negotiate repairs and credits or use an inspection contingency to walk away.
  • Focus negotiations on the most expensive and severe repairs and get repair estimates to inform seller concessions.
  • Minor pest problems are a fairly easy fix akin to cosmetic eyesores, electrical upgrades, and other expenses that come with the territory of homeownership.
  • You may have grounds for a lawsuit if a seller knowingly conceals a pest problem or other home defect and you suffer monetary damages.
